Output 36d0221120526e24210c6e43f808a22f585289c8fb8cbfbd4ba61471bd060f31:10

value
89607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04881e370006efec6b6b1ed3ba128f203ca53e5c OP_EQUAL
address
326ygxUsLrAZEDokiQyJwAeC5kZ6yX2syD
transaction
36d0221120526e24210c6e43f808a22f585289c8fb8cbfbd4ba61471bd060f31
spent
true